1. Install all parts of the mod as instructed above.
2. Open "Steam/Steamapps/Common/Medieval II Total War/mods". There you
will find all your installed Kingdoms campaigns as well as the
"EoR" modfolder.
3. Edit the name of one of the Kingdoms folders (americas, britannia,
crusades, teutonic), preferably your least favorite campaign. The new
name doesn't have to be anything specific.
4. Change the name of the "EoR" folder to the former name of the
Kingdoms folder you just edited. For example, if you edited the
"americas" folder, the "EoR" folder should be named "americas".
5. Select the appropriate campaign from the steam menu. If you renamed
the "EoR" folder to "americas", select the americas campaign. If you
named it "crusades", select the crusades campaign and so on.
6. Steam will now launch the mod.
-Right click your Medieval 2 wrapper icon and show package contents
-Drop the EoR.exe's into c:
-Open Wineskin from within the wrapper
-Advanced -> Set executable to EoR Pt. 1 -> Done -> Exit Wineskin
-Double click Medieval 2 wrapper - the EoR install program will start -> Install EoR
-Repeat for EoR Pt. 2 & Patch 3.1
-Open wineskin and set executable to the executable.bat file in the mods folder of Medieval 2 folder in drive c: within the wrapper contents.
-Double Click Medieval 2 Wrapper and enjoy.
